I agree with MissionDental. An interview is not a fashion show. Dress conservatively, and professionally. Think of what a 50-year old academic would consider to look nice and shoot for that. Express your creativity, uniqueness, and qualifiaction through your extracurriculars and academic performance. It's boring, I know, but these are the unspoken rules of this game.
